Aston Martin F1 News: Team Releases AMR23 Reveal Date For Next Season’s Car

Aston Martin is set to unveil its new 2023 F1 car, the AMR23, on February 13th, 2023 at an event held at Silverstone. The event, which will be broadcast across digital channels as well as being attended by a small audience, marks the official reveal of the highly anticipated car.

The team’s previous car, the AMR22, faced several challenges during the 2022 season, with issues similar to those experienced by Mercedes at the beginning of the year. In response, the team made significant changes to the car’s design starting with the Spanish Grand Prix, adopting a similar approach to Red Bull. These changes ultimately led to improvements for the team, and they ended the season in seventh place in the constructor’s championship.

Technical director Dan Fallows has hinted at further changes being made to the AMR23, stating that there will be “significant” modifications to the car. Fans of the team will no doubt be eager to see what these changes will be and how they will impact the performance of the car.

He said the following:

“I mean there is a limit to what we can do with the current rules. I know that new cars always have to pass my test of my children. So if I put them in front of my children and they say they look different, then they look different.

“They always say they all look the same, daddy! But within the envelope of the rules that we have, then yes, there are significant differences on the AMR23.”

In addition to the reveal of the new car, fans will also be excited to see the team’s new driver line up for the 2023 season. Spanish F1 legend Fernando Alonso will be joining Aston Martin and will be driving alongside Lance Stroll. Alonso had his first run with the team at the post-season testing in Abu Dhabi, giving fans a sneak peek at what they can expect from the two drivers next season.
